How to Download the CTET Marksheet and Certificate from DigiLocker

Once CTET December 2024 marksheet and certificate are uploaded to DigiLocker, candidates can download them using the mobile number they provided in application form.Here are the steps to download your CTET December 2024 certificate and marksheet from DigiLocker:

Step 1: Visit the DigiLocker website or open the DigiLocker app.

Step 2: Use the mobile number provided in your CTET application form to log in.

Step 3: Once logged in, go to the "Issued Documents" section.

Step 4: Find your CTET December 2024 marksheet and certificate, and click on "Download" to save them.

Ensure your DigiLocker account is active and linked to the correct mobile number for easy access.

Key Details about CTET December 2024 Examination

Particulars Registered Candidates Appeared Candidates Qualified Candidates
Paper I (Classes I to V) 6,86,197 5,72,489 1,38,389
Paper II ( Classes VI to VIII) 13,62,884 11,36,087 1,39,888

CTET Marksheet and Certificate 2024 FAQs

Ques. Is it mandatory to download the certificate from DigiLocker?

Ans. No, it is not mandatory to download the certificate from DigiLocker. However, DigiLocker provides a secure, convenient, and government-approved method to store and access your certificates digitally.

Ques. What should I do if I have trouble logging into DigiLocker?

Ans. If you face any issues while logging into DigiLocker, you can reset your password or seek support through the DigiLocker website or app. Make sure to use the mobile number you registered with during CTET application process.

Ques. Are DigiLocker certificates valid for official use?

Ans. Yes, the documents available in DigiLocker are considered valid and authentic, as they are issued by government agencies.

Ques. Is DigiLocker accessible from a mobile phone?

Ans. Yes, you can access DigiLocker through its mobile app, which is available for download on both Android and iOS.
